Practical Designer Notes for Implementation

Before integrating this asset into your next campaign, consider these technical and aesthetic checks to ensure modern design standards are met:

  1. Test with Your Color Palette: Ensure the orange pufferfish complements your existing brand colors. It pairs well with blues, teals, and neutrals but may clash with warm analogous colors.
  2. Check Black and White Usage: If you plan to use this for single-color printing, verify that the details hold up without color differentiation.
  3. Font Pairing: This illustration works best with bold sans-serif fonts or playful handwritten fonts. Avoid delicate serif fonts that may look too fragile next to the spiky character.
  4. Spacing and Balance: Give the asset breathing room. Crowding it with other elements diminishes its impact. Use negative space to let the grumpy expression stand out.
  5. Licensing Verification: Always confirm the commercial license terms. Ensure you have the right to use the SVG design or PNG design in paid campaigns, client work, and physical product sales.
